Coupled thermomechanical analysis of fused deposition using the finite element method
Abstract
A novel finite element-based simulation method is proposed for fused deposition modeling in two dimensions. The method assumes full coupling between the mechanical and thermal response under the assumptions of infinitesimal deformation and finite temperature variation.
